WebLeave at least 2 or 3 feet of space between the end of the fan blade to the closest wall to determine the largest size fan you can put in a room (3 feet for ceilings 9 feet or less, 2 feet for higher ceilings). WebGenerally speaking, for a room up to 144 square feet, choose a 24-inch (small) ceiling fan. For rooms between 144 and 225 square feet, a 36-inch ceiling fan is big enough. For larger rooms, you will need a larger fan. For example, for a room up to 400 square feet, you should opt for a 52-inch fan. WebSelect a fan with the appropriate span: 36 inches for rooms up to 100 square feet, 42 inches for up to 200 square feet, 52 inches for up to 400 square feet, and either one 60-inch fan …

WebA 48-inch fan is too big. A 36-inch fan is too small. A 42-inch ceiling fan is just right for a 12×12 room.
